*{box-sizing:border-box;margin:0;padding:0}body{color:#d1d5db;background:#121212;font-family:Arial,sans-serif;line-height:1.7}img{width:100%;display:block}.app-layout{grid-template-columns:320px 1fr;gap:30px;max-width:1400px;margin:auto;padding:5px;display:grid}.sidebar{background:#1f1f1f;border:1px solid #333;border-radius:20px;height:fit-content;padding:30px;position:sticky;top:0}.profile{text-align:center}.profile img{object-fit:cover;border:4px solid #ffbf00;border-radius:50%;width:130px;height:130px;margin:auto}.profile h2{color:#e0e0e0;margin-top:20px}.profile p{color:#ffbf00;background:#2d2d2d;border-radius:8px;margin-top:10px;padding:6px 16px;display:inline-block}.contact-info{border-top:1px solid #333;margin-top:30px;padding-top:25px}.contact-info div{margin-bottom:20px}.contact-info h4{color:#9ca3af;margin-bottom:5px}.contact-info a,.contact-info span{color:#e0e0e0}.social-links{gap:15px;display:flex}.social-links a{color:#ffbf00;border:1px solid #333;border-radius:10px;padding:10px 14px;transition:all .3s}.social-links a:hover{color:#000;background:#ffbf00}.content-area{background:#1f1f1f;border:1px solid #333;border-radius:20px;overflow:hidden}.navbar{background:#222;border-bottom:2px solid #333;justify-content:space-between;align-items:center;padding:20px 30px;display:flex}.logo{color:#e0e0e0}.nav-links{gap:30px;list-style:none;display:flex}.nav-links a{color:#e0e0e0;text-decoration:none;transition:all .3s}.nav-links a:hover,.nav-links .active{color:#ffbf00}.page{padding:5px}.hero-title{color:#e0e0e0;padding-left:5px;font-size:2rem}.hero-text{text-align:justify;color:#a0a0a0;max-width:700px;margin-top:5px;padding-left:5px;padding-right:5px}.section-title{color:#e0e0e0;font-size:2rem}.section-line{background:#ffbf00;border-radius:20px;width:70px;height:5px;margin:5px 0 20px}.about{margin-top:15px}.about p{text-align:justify;color:#a0a0a0}.skills{margin-top:15px}.skills-grid{perspective:1200px;grid-template-columns:repeat(auto-fit,minmax(180px,1fr));gap:20px;display:grid}.skill-card{text-align:center;z-index:1;background:#171717;border:1px solid #2a2a2a;border-radius:18px;flex-direction:column;justify-content:center;min-height:180px;padding:30px;transition:transform .3s,box-shadow .3s;display:flex;position:relative;overflow:hidden}.skill-card:before{content:"";filter:blur(12px);z-index:-2;background:conic-gradient(#ffbf00 0deg 80deg,#0000 80deg 90deg,#2196f3 90deg 170deg,#0000 170deg 180deg,#ffbf00 180deg 260deg,#0000 260deg 270deg,#2196f3 270deg 350deg,#0000 350deg 360deg);width:250%;height:250%;animation:15s linear infinite rotateBorder;position:absolute;top:-75%;left:-75%}.skill-card:after{content:"";z-index:-1;background:#171717;border-radius:16px;position:absolute;inset:2px}.skill-card:hover{transform:translateY(-5px)scale(1.03);box-shadow:0 0 20px #ffbf0040,0 0 35px #2196f340}@keyframes rotateBorder{to{transform:rotate(360deg)}}.skills-grid .skill-card:first-child{animation-delay:.1s}.skills-grid .skill-card:nth-child(2){animation-delay:.2s}.skills-grid .skill-card:nth-child(3){animation-delay:.3s}.skills-grid .skill-card:nth-child(4){animation-delay:.4s}.skills-grid .skill-card:nth-child(5){animation-delay:.5s}.skills-grid .skill-card:nth-child(6){animation-delay:.6s}.skill-card:hover{box-shadow:0 20px 40px #ffbf0026}.skill-card img{object-fit:contain;filter:invert(75%)sepia(50%)saturate(1000%)hue-rotate(350deg)brightness(110%)contrast(101%);width:60px;height:60px;margin:auto;transition:transform .4s}.skill-card:hover img{transform:scale(1.12)}.skill-card h3{color:#a0a0a0;margin-top:10px;font-size:.9rem;transition:color .3s}.skill-card:hover h3{color:#ffbf00}@keyframes cardFadeIn{to{opacity:1;transform:translateY(0)scale(1)}}.projects-grid{grid-template-columns:repeat(auto-fit,minmax(300px,1fr));gap:25px;display:grid}.project-card{z-index:1;background:#171717;border:1px solid #2a2a2a;border-radius:18px;transition:transform .3s;position:relative;overflow:hidden}.project-card:before{content:"";filter:blur(12px);z-index:-2;background:conic-gradient(#ffbf00 0deg 80deg,#0000 80deg 90deg,#2196f3 90deg 170deg,#0000 170deg 180deg,#ffbf00 180deg 260deg,#0000 260deg 270deg,#2196f3 270deg 350deg,#0000 350deg 360deg);width:250%;height:250%;animation:25s linear infinite rotateBorder;position:absolute;top:-75%;left:-75%}.project-card:after{content:"";z-index:-1;background:#171717;border-radius:16px;position:absolute;inset:2px}.project-card:hover{box-shadow:0 20px 40px #ffbf0026}.project-card img{object-fit:cover;border-radius:12px;padding:4px}.project-content{color:#a0a0a0;padding:20px}.project-content h3{color:#e0e0e0;margin-bottom:10px}.tags{flex-wrap:wrap;gap:10px;margin-top:15px;display:flex}.tags span{color:#ffbf00;background:#ffbf001a;border-radius:6px;padding:5px 10px}.project-buttons{flex-wrap:wrap;gap:10px;margin-top:20px;display:flex}.store-btn{color:#000;cursor:pointer;background:#deb027;border:none;border-radius:8px;padding:10px 16px;font-weight:600;transition:all .3s}.store-btn:hover{opacity:.85;transform:translateY(-2px)}.contact-section{padding:10px}.contact-form{flex-direction:column;gap:20px;display:flex}.contact-form input,.contact-form textarea{color:#e0e0e0;background:#171717;border:1px solid #333;border-radius:10px;padding:15px}.contact-form textarea{resize:none;min-height:150px}.contact-form button{cursor:pointer;background:#ffbf00;border:none;border-radius:10px;padding:15px;font-weight:700}.contact-title{color:#e0e0e0;margin-bottom:10px;font-size:28px;font-weight:700}.contact-subtitle{color:#999;margin-bottom:25px;font-size:14px;line-height:1.5}.form-group{text-align:left;flex-direction:column;gap:8px;display:flex}.form-group label{color:#cfcfcf;font-size:14px;font-weight:500}.required{color:#ff4d4f;margin-left:4px;font-weight:700}.contact-form input:focus,.contact-form textarea:focus{border-color:#ffbf00;outline:none;transition:all .2s;box-shadow:0 0 0 2px #ffbf0026}.contact-form button:hover{opacity:.95;transition:all .2s;transform:translateY(-1px)}.contact-success{color:#22c55e;margin-top:10px;font-size:14px}.contact-error{color:#ef4444;margin-top:10px;font-size:14px}@media (width<=992px){.app-layout{grid-template-columns:1fr}.sidebar{position:static}}@media (width<=768px){.navbar{flex-direction:column;gap:15px}.nav-links{flex-wrap:wrap;justify-content:center;gap:15px}.hero-title{font-size:2rem}.page{padding:20px}.projects-grid{grid-template-columns:1fr}.skills-grid{grid-template-columns:1fr 1fr}.sidebar{position:static}}@media (width<=500px){.skills-grid{grid-template-columns:repeat(2,minmax(0,1fr));align-items:stretch;gap:10px}.skill-card{flex-direction:column;justify-content:center;min-height:100px;padding:15px 10px;display:flex}.skill-card h3{word-break:break-word;font-size:.75rem;line-height:1.3}.profile img{width:90px;height:90px}.hero-title{font-size:1.6rem}.section-title{font-size:1.5rem}.nav-links a{font-size:14px}.sidebar{position:static}.hero-text,.about p,.about .content{text-align:left}}@media (width<=360px){.app-layout{gap:15px;padding:5px}.sidebar{padding:15px}.profile img{width:80px;height:80px}.page{padding:10px}.hero-title,.section-title{padding-left:0;font-size:1.4rem}.nav-links{gap:8px}.nav-links a{font-size:14px}.skills-grid{grid-template-columns:1fr;gap:8px}.hero-text,.about p,.about .content{text-align:left}}
